What is a conservative?

Conservatives are individuals who generally uphold traditional values and institutions, and often advocate for limited government, free-market economics, and a cautious approach to social and political change. The term is most commonly associated with political beliefs that emphasize preserving established customs and promoting individual responsibility. While the specifics can vary by country, conservatives typically prioritize national security, fiscal responsibility, and traditional cultural norms. In the United States, conservatives are often aligned with the Republican Party, while in other countries, conservative parties may have different names and platforms.

What are some common challenges faced by a conservationist in balancing environmental goals with community needs?

As a Conservationist, one of the most frequent challenges is finding a balance between protecting natural resources and addressing the needs of local communities who may rely on those resources for their livelihoods. This often involves engaging in open dialogue with stakeholders, conducting thorough environmental impact assessments, and developing management plans that aim for sustainable use rather than strict preservation. Effective Conservationists must be skilled in negotiation and collaboration, working closely with government agencies, non-profits, and local residents to create solutions that benefit both the environment and the people who depend on it.

Job description

Turning Point Action is a 501(c)(4) organization founded in 2019 by Charlie Kirk. The organization's mission is to embolden the conservative base through grassroots activism and provide voters with the necessary resources to elect true conservative leaders. Turning Point Action has emerged as the country's leading grassroots organization, giving individuals the opportunity and platform to run for office at the local level, providing voters with critical information surrounding their district's candidates and elections, allowing them unparalleled access to some of the most impactful figures in the movement. Turning Point Action is on a mission to save America, one precinct at a time.

ABOUT THE POSITION:

Turning Point Action is seeking a Part Time Executive Administrator to provide comprehensive administrative tasks for the Executive team. The responsibilities of this role include, but are not limited to managing and paying incoming invoices, promptly responding to external and internal parties regarding scheduling, keeping an inventory of and restocking office materials, and any other administrative tasks relating to the team. This is an entry level position.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

The primary responsibilities include, but are not limited to the following:

  • Data entry with google sheets.
  • Promptly paying and tracking incoming invoices.
  • Responding to inquiries from the Executive team.
  • Managing professional relationships with other conservative organizations.
  • Organizing and maintaining the Turning Point Action Airtable database.
  • Updating the Google Drive when needed.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Knowledge of Google Drive (Google Docs, Sheets)
  • Passion for conservative ideas and principles
  • Extremely organized
  • Strong work ethic and goal-oriented
  • Self-starter and self-motivated
  • Punctual and extremely responsive
